Jersey: Minimum Wage - Consultation on changes from April 2010

The Employment Forum has published a series of documents to gather views on increasing Jersey’s minimum wage from April 2010 and on three specific issues, namely

  • whether Jersey should follow the UK’s decision to prevent tips and gratuities being used by employers to meet their minimum wage obligations
  • whether other offsets and benefits, such as gas, electricity, water, laundry services and uniforms, should be added to the existing offsets for accommodation and meals
  • whether a student or youth rate should be introduced in addition to the existing minimum rate and trainee rate.

The deadline for responses in 9 September 2009
